EASTBOUND I-435 AT U.S. 69 TO CLOSE OVERNIGHT FOR A WEEKEND

With the end of the I-435/Antioch interchange project in sight, crews are working quickly to get the flyover ramp complete.

Starting Friday, May 16, crews will close all eastbound lanes of I-435 near the U.S. 69 interchange overnight so they can construct the flyover.

The closure will include:

  • All eastbound lanes of I-435 from U.S. 69 to Antioch Road
  • The ramp from eastbound I-435 to northbound U.S. 69, and
  • The ramp from southbound U.S. 69 to eastbound I-435.

Crews will close the highway starting at 10 p.m., reopening it to traffic at 8 a.m. Saturday, May 17.

The closure will occur again Saturday night starting at 10 p.m. and reopen to traffic at 10 a.m., Sunday, May 18.

Project work is scheduled to be completed Sunday, weather permitting.

Marked detours will be provided. Traffic on eastbound I-435 will detour south on U.S. 69 to College Boulevard, then back north to I-435. Drivers should expect major delays and use an alternate route if possible.

This bridge work is part of a four year, $127 million project that includes an interchange at Antioch and I-435, a two-lane fly-over ramp from southbound U.S. 69 to eastbound I-435, additional lanes on I-435 and sound barrier walls on I-435 and U.S. 69.

Construction is expected to be finished in the fall with restoration complete by the spring of 2009.

According to the current schedule, by the end of this year, the inside shoulder of southbound U.S. 69 will be widened, the flyover ramp from southbound U.S. 69 to eastbound I- 435 will be complete; and noise walls will be installed along the east side of U.S. 69 from 103rd to 95th streets.
